visual studio 2008 - studio - Asistente de publicación de bases de datos SQL con SQL Server 2008
visual studio code php mysql (4)
El asistente de publicación de bases de datos SQL está en Visual Studio 2008:
Paso 1: cree un nuevo sitio web seleccionando menú Archivo -> Nuevo sitio web. Cambie a Server Explorer y agregue una nueva conexión de datos y conéctese a una base de datos. En este caso, utilizaremos la base de datos Northwind que viene con SQL Express. Debe señalar a la base de datos que desea publicar.
Paso 2: Seleccione el nodo Northwind.dbo en el Explorador del servidor y haga clic con el botón derecho para abrir el menú contextual. En el menú contextual tiene una opción "Publicar en proveedor ...".
Ref .
Debería poder apuntar a una base de datos en su máquina local y luego crear automáticamente un archivo de script .SQL que contenga la lógica de configuración necesaria para volver a crear una réplica de la base de datos en cualquier sistema remoto, por ejemplo, un sistema de alojamiento externo. Este script .SQL incluye todo lo necesario para crear el esquema de la base de datos (tablas, vistas, sprocs, desencadenadores, catálogos de texto completo, roles, reglas, etc.). También tiene la opción de rellenar la nueva base de datos con los mismos contenidos de datos que sus tablas locales.
La mayoría de los proveedores de alojamiento hoy en día soportan la carga y ejecución de archivos .SQL en sus entornos alojados utilizando sus paneles de control de administración. Entonces, todo lo que necesita hacer es cargar y ejecutar el script .SQL generado por el Asistente de Publicación de Base de Datos, y tendrá una base de datos en funcionamiento en su entorno alojado.
Estoy buscando desesperadamente el asistente de publicación de bases de datos SQL. Lo descargué pero parece requerir SQL Server 2005. Según http://blogs.msdn.com/webdevtools/archive/2007/10/15/sql-database-publishing-wizard-is-now-in- visual-studio-orcas.aspx viene con Visual Studio 2008, pero mi Visual Studio 2008 Professional no tiene ese elemento de menú.
Alguna idea de cómo puedo hacer que el asistente de publicación de bases de datos SQL trabaje con SQL Server 2008.
Encontré la solución en línea. Estos son los pasos para resolver el problema en caso de que alguien más tenga el mismo problema. Gracias.
Abra el Panel de control y vaya a Agregar o quitar programas.
Haga clic con el botón derecho en el componente ''Asistente de publicación de la base de datos del servidor Microsoft Sql 1.3'' (o ''Asistente de publicación en la base de datos del servidor Sql de Microsoft 1.2'' si esta versión anterior se instaló debido a (b) arriba, y luego haga clic en Desinstalar. Espere a que finalice la desinstalación.
Ejecute SqlPubWizInstaller.exe desde http://go.microsoft.com/fwlink/?LinkId=119368 para reinstalar ''Microsoft Sql Server Database Publishing Wizard 1.3''. Puede verificar que se instaló mirando en Agregar o quitar programas.
Incluso este hilo es viejo y creado hace mucho tiempo ... solo quiero compartir la solución que creo que puede ser útil para alguien ...
Abra SSMS (Management Studio) y haga clic con el botón derecho en la base de datos. Seleccione Tareas -> Generar secuencias de comandos. Seleccione el botón de opción "Script entero de la base de datos y todos los objetos de la base de datos" y haga clic en Siguiente.
En la pantalla "Opciones de scripting", haga clic en el botón "Avanzado" y, en General, cambie "Tipos de datos a secuencia de comandos" a "Esquema y datos".
Esto generará una secuencia de comandos completa con datos y esquema.
Instale "SQL Server Express Edition con herramientas", luego instale el asistente de publicación.